What Are Hearing Screening Tests?

Hearing screening tests are quick, non-invasive assessments used to check how well you can hear different sounds, tones, and frequencies. These tests are designed to identify potential hearing problems early, even before symptoms become obvious.

At an ear health clinic in Brockworth, hearing screening tests are suitable for adults of all ages and can be especially beneficial for older adults, people exposed to loud noise, and those experiencing symptoms such as ringing in the ears or difficulty understanding speech.

Types of Hearing Screening Tests Available

1. Pure Tone Audiometry

Pure tone audiometry is one of the most common hearing screening tests. It measures your ability to hear sounds at different pitches and volumes. During the test, you wear headphones and respond when you hear a tone. The results help determine the degree and type of hearing loss, if present.

2. Tympanometry

Tympanometry assesses the function of the middle ear and eardrum. It helps identify issues such as fluid build-up, ear infections, or eustachian tube dysfunction. This test is quick and provides valuable information about ear pressure and mobility.

3. Speech Audiometry

Speech audiometry evaluates how well you can hear and understand spoken words. This test is useful for identifying difficulties with speech clarity, even when sounds are loud enough.

4. Otoscopy Examination

An otoscopy allows the clinician to visually inspect the ear canal and eardrum. This is often the first step in hearing screening tests and helps detect earwax build-up, inflammation, or structural issues.

Earwax and Hearing Screening

Excess earwax is a common cause of temporary hearing loss. Before conducting hearing screening tests, clinicians may assess and remove impacted earwax if necessary. Clearing the ear canal ensures accurate test results and can immediately improve hearing in some cases.

How Often Should You Have a Hearing Test?

For most adults, a hearing screening test every two to three years is recommended. However, if you are at higher risk of hearing loss or notice changes in your hearing, more frequent testing may be advised. Your ear health specialist can recommend a suitable schedule based on your needs.
